  • 1985 Campeonato Brasileiro Série A - Wikipedia
    The 1985 Campeonato Brasileiro Série A was the 29th edition of the Campeonato Brasileiro Série A Coritiba won the championship for the first time, beating Bangu in the finals; both qualified for the 1986 Copa Libertadores
